There is no direct connection from Merrimac to Nantucket. However, you can take the taxi to Newburyport, take the bus to Boston, take the bus to Hyannis Transportation Center, walk to Hyannis, MA, then take the ferry to Nantucket.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Merri Village to Nantucket via Emerson St & Merrimack St, Haverhill Amtrak, Boston, North Station, Chinatown, Boston South Station, Hyannis Transportation Center, and Hyannis, MA in around 7h 16m.
